A gate valve repair at the corner of North Center and State streets on Wednesday morning was completed with no significant issues.
“Everything went as planned,” said Steve Disney, executive director of the Bradford City Water Authority.
During the repairs, water service to some residents on those two streets, along with School Street Elementary School, was off as work was completed. Bradford elementary schools had a two-hour delay to accommodate the project.
Disney said the water was shut off about 7 a.m. It was restored to the elementary school by 10 a.m. and to all other customers by 11 a.m. “It pretty much went off without a hitch,” he said.
The water authority had to dig up the valve and replace it, as it has been leaking the last couple of weeks, causing issues for the agency.
